a hard choice, because both kits have advantages and disadvantages.

I guess i would finally go for the Dragon kit. If i wanted to make Michael Rinaldi style turret, get the Trumpeter kit also and swap turrets.

Dragon:
advantage is the Tracks and the side skirts breakdown which is more accurate.
disadvantage: many sink marks on the wheels, multipiece lower hull (pay attention in assembly), missing detail on the inner sideskirts.

Trumpeter:
advantage: crisp molding, lots of nice details and option parts (Infrared), cool turret, one piece lower hull.Inner sideskirt detail.
disadvantage: breakdown of the sideskirts = the frontskirt is too long, the rear one too short in my opinion. Rubberband tracks (there is a resin AM set available by Atelier infinite with optional workable suspension).

I have both kits, that is the easiest choice. The sideskits are hard to correct, youŽd have to make one shorter, one longer and have to change all the hull details on each side.....just leave them of.
